(ALBANY, GA) — A North Albany restaurant is making sure that hospital staff aren’t going hungry, while keeping their employees busy.

Eggs Up Grill has been taking in donations to help with sending food to Phoebe Putney Hospital as well as the Salvation Army.

Owner, Michael McNeal says that he’s also been able to use the support from the community to help pay his staff and avoid layoffs.

He tells us, “I worried about not being able to provide the work for them, but now that the community’s come together, and allowing us to help them feed the hospital and Salvation Army, that’s been a blessing for us.”
